Basement Water Extraction Cost in Trophy Club, TX
The cost of Basement Water Extraction in Trophy Club,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Get a free estimate. No hidden costs. Transparent pricing.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of service. |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of service. |
| Inspection and ass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of damage, and complexity of the job. |
| Repair and rest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of damage, and complexity of the job. |
| Emergency response | $500 – $2,000 | Time of day,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
